WebA share price – or a stock price – is the amount it would cost to buy one share in a company. The price of a share is not fixed, but fluctuates according to market conditions. It will likely increase if the company is perceived to be doing well, or fall if the company isn’t meeting expectations. How are share prices determined? WebDec 24, 2024 · 2. Look for lines of support and resistance. Next, you’ll want to identify lines of support and resistance. A line of support is a price that a stock is unlikely to drop below, while a line of resistance is one that it’s unlikely to go above. That is, until some major change occurs, such as a reduced profit margin.

WebAug 31, 2024 · The rights issue is a primary market issue. The offer is made to the existing shareholders and not to the general public. It is the right of the shareholder and not an obligation to buy the additional shares.
